A prospect is eager to conduct a Security Lifecycle Review (SLR) with the aid of the Palo Alto Networks NGFW. Which interface type is best suited to provide the raw data for an SLR from the network in a way that is minimally invasive?

The typical and most basic SLR deployment will use TAP mode interfaces, where the firewall can be connected to a core switch’s span port to identify applications running on the network. This option requires no changes to the existing network design.
